Our Portland Hawaiian Band Members

Josh Gilbert has been playing music professionally for over two decades. Some years ago he visited Hawaii for the first time, bought a ukulele on Kauai, and became fascinated by Hawaiian music. He has since returned to the islands many times, and expanded his knowledge of Hawaiian music and culture. Later, he decided to start his own Portland Hawaiian Band to bring the beautiful music of the islands to the Pacific northwest. He teaches ukulele, flute, saxophone, and clarinet in the Portland area, and plays in numerous local bands, including The Little Big Band.

Twayn Williams is a gypsy jazz, swing and steel guitarist as well as band leader in Portland OR. Classically educated with degrees in classical guitar performance and composition, he has played a wide variety of styles since including rock, world beat, avant garde and has lately added the sweet sounds of the Hawaiian steel guitar to his repertoire. An in-demand player in the local gypsy jazz and swing scene, he leads The Courtney Freed Five and The Hot Club du Jour as well as being a featured performer with The Ne Plus Ultra Jass Orchestra Ensemble Gitane, The Hot Club of Hawthorne, The Newport Nightingales and other swing bands.

Bernardo Gomez started as a classically trained musician in grade 6. After college he explored music from his Latin roots as well as Jazz. Today he can be found playing around town with groups such as Hot Club De Jour, The Little Big Band and The Shanghai Woolies
